Features :
Space saving realized by digitalization
The Medical Imaging System can be configured simply by installing the FCR Reader, the CR Console, and the Imager to your existing X-ray equipment. The Imager uses the dry film for output and therefore does not require a dark room as in conventional systems thus saving space. Also, the scanned image can be digitally saved to media and not on films, thus not much storage space is required.

Supports diagnosis using the latest image processing technology
In the conventional Screen Film System, obtaining a stable quality image was difficult and the setting of the X-ray exposure conditions was dependent on the experience of the radiologist. However, in the FCRSystem, a stable and high-quality image is obtained through the use of the latest imaging technology. The images can be further processed on the CR Console by adjusting the parameters or by using specialized image processing techniques to obtain an optimum image for pertinent diagnosis.
